当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

kvm虚拟机显卡驱动,深入探讨KVM虚拟机显卡驱动技术及其优化策略

kvm虚拟机显卡驱动,深入探讨KVM虚拟机显卡驱动技术及其优化策略

本文深入探讨KVM虚拟机显卡驱动技术,分析了其工作原理,并提出了优化策略,旨在提升虚拟机显卡性能,为用户提供更流畅的图形处理体验。...

本文深入探讨KVM虚拟机显卡驱动技术,分析了其工作原理,并提出了优化策略,旨在提升虚拟机显卡性能,为用户提供更流畅的图形处理体验。

随着虚拟化技术的不断发展,KVM(Kernel-based Virtual Machine)作为一种开源的虚拟化解决方案,在服务器、云计算等领域得到了广泛的应用,在KVM虚拟机中,显卡驱动是影响虚拟机性能的关键因素之一,本文将深入探讨KVM虚拟机显卡驱动技术,并针对性能优化提出一些策略。

KVM虚拟机显卡驱动概述

1、KVM虚拟机显卡驱动类型

KVM虚拟机显卡驱动主要分为以下几种类型:

kvm虚拟机显卡驱动,深入探讨KVM虚拟机显卡驱动技术及其优化策略

(1)VGA驱动:提供基本的图形功能,支持基本的图形显示。

(2)qemu-gpu驱动:针对KVM虚拟机的GPU设备,提供更好的图形性能。

(3)vga、cirrus、vesa等驱动:这些驱动为不同类型的显卡设备提供支持。

2、KVM虚拟机显卡驱动工作原理

KVM虚拟机显卡驱动通过以下步骤实现虚拟机的图形显示:

(1)虚拟机操作系统启动时,加载相应的显卡驱动。

(2)虚拟机操作系统通过驱动程序与虚拟化层进行交互,将用户操作的图形事件发送到虚拟化层。

(3)虚拟化层将图形事件转换为虚拟机的显卡事件,并将事件发送到宿主机的显卡设备。

(4)宿主机的显卡设备处理事件,将图形结果显示在屏幕上。

kvm虚拟机显卡驱动,深入探讨KVM虚拟机显卡驱动技术及其优化策略

KVM虚拟机显卡驱动性能优化策略

1、选择合适的显卡驱动

针对不同的应用场景,选择合适的显卡驱动可以提高虚拟机的性能,以下是一些常见的显卡驱动选择策略:

(1)对于基本图形显示需求,可以选择vga、cirrus、vesa等驱动。

(2)对于需要较高图形性能的应用,可以选择qemu-gpu驱动。

2、调整显卡配置参数

(1)启用硬件加速:通过启用硬件加速,可以提高虚拟机的图形性能,在KVM虚拟机中,可以通过修改配置文件启用硬件加速。

(2)调整显存大小:适当增加显存大小可以提高虚拟机的图形性能,在KVM虚拟机中,可以通过修改配置文件调整显存大小。

3、优化虚拟机操作系统

(1)关闭不必要的图形特效:在虚拟机操作系统中关闭不必要的图形特效,可以减少图形渲染负担,提高虚拟机的性能。

kvm虚拟机显卡驱动,深入探讨KVM虚拟机显卡驱动技术及其优化策略

(2)优化图形驱动:定期更新虚拟机操作系统的图形驱动,以获得更好的性能和稳定性。

4、使用GPU直通技术

GPU直通技术可以将宿主机的显卡设备直接分配给虚拟机使用,从而提高虚拟机的图形性能,以下是一些使用GPU直通技术的注意事项:

(1)确保宿主机显卡设备支持GPU直通。

(2)在创建虚拟机时,选择GPU直通选项。

(3)在虚拟机操作系统中安装相应的显卡驱动。

KVM虚拟机显卡驱动是影响虚拟机性能的关键因素之一,通过选择合适的显卡驱动、调整显卡配置参数、优化虚拟机操作系统以及使用GPU直通技术,可以有效提高KVM虚拟机的图形性能,在实际应用中,根据具体需求选择合适的优化策略,将有助于提高虚拟化环境的生产力。

黑狐家游戏

发表评论

最新文章